-
Câu hỏi:
Hãy chọn đoạn lệnh đúng khi viết hàm nhập số nguyên n từ bàn phím. Hàm sẽ trả lại số đã nhập.
-
A.
def NhapDL() n = int(("Nhập số nguyên n: ")) return n
-
B.
def NhapDL(): n = int(("Nhập số nguyên n: ")) return n
-
C.
def NhapDL(): n = float(("Nhập số nguyên n: ")) return n
-
D.
def NhapDL(): n = int(("Nhập số nguyên n: "))
Lời giải tham khảo:
Đáp án đúng: B
- Viết hàm nhập số nguyên n từ bàn phím. Hàm sẽ trả lại số đã nhập bằng đoạn lệnh:
def NhapDL():
n = int(("Nhập số nguyên n: "))
return n
- A sai vì thiếu dấu : ở phía sau câu lệnh đầu tiên
- C sai vì float là kiểu số thực
- D sai vì thiếu lệnh return trả lại giá trị ở cuối đoạn lệnh
Đáp án B
Hãy trả lời câu hỏi trước khi xem đáp án và lời giải -
A.
Câu hỏi này thuộc đề thi trắc nghiệm dưới đây, bấm vào Bắt đầu thi để làm toàn bài
CÂU HỎI KHÁC
- Đoạn chương trình sau: def t(a1,b1):
- Hãy chọn đoạn lệnh đúng khi viết hàm nhập số nguyên n từ bàn phím.
- Đâu là hàm được dùng trong Python?
- Hàm func(m, n) định nghĩa như sau:
- Đoạn chương trình sau đây sẽ in ra kết quả thế nào?
- Với đoạn chương trình sau:
- Lỗi sai trong đoạn chương trình sau là gì
- Cuối dòng đầu tiên của định nghĩa hàm phải có dấu nào sau đây?
- Muốn sử dụng hàm sqrt() ta cần khai báo thư viện nào?
- Khi gọi hàm, dữ liệu được truyền vào hàm gọi là gì?